After flying high against Corydon Central on Wednesday, Borden came back down to earth. The Braves fell 3-1 to the Orleans Bulldogs on Thursday. The Braves were given a dose of their own medicine in this game as the Bulldogs apparently hadn't forgotten their loss the last time these teams played back in October of 2024.
The match finished with set scores of 25-21, 20-25, 25-21, 25-14.
McKenna Mullen paced Borden's offense, picking up 13 kills. Mullen got some help from Alivia Thomas and her 25 assists.
Orleans was led to victory by Hayley Hess and Addison Russell. Hess had 15 digs and one assist, while Russell had 15 digs, ten kills, and four aces. Russell is on a roll when it comes to kills, as she's now had seven or more in each of the last five games she's played.
Borden dropped their record down to 17-10 with the defeat, which was their third straight at home. As for Orleans, they have been performing incredibly well recently as they've won six of their last seven contests. That's provided a massive bump to their 17-10 record this season.
Borden will take on New Washington at 7:15 p.m. on Tuesday. Orleans does not have any more games scheduled as of now.
